Product Description
GE VMIVME-4150 is a 6U VMEbus isolated 12-bit analog output board from GE Fanuc VMIC, built for high-precision signal conversion in industrial automation and process control systems. GE VMIVME-4150 offers 4/8/12 fully isolated channels (1000 VDC standard isolation, up to 1500 VDC optional) for channel-to-channel and channel-to-bus protection. GE VMIVME-4150 supports software-selectable voltage ranges (±2.5V/±5V/±10V unipolar/bipolar) and optional 4-20mA current loops, with 0.05% voltage accuracy and 0.08% current loop accuracy. GE VMIVME-4150 integrates optical data coupling for full galvanic isolation, static readback registers for program control, and front-panel access for field wiring and diagnostics. GE VMIVME-4150 operates stably in -40°C to +70°C industrial environments, with outputs automatically placed in a minimal state at reset and a front-panel Fail LED for fault indication. GE VMIVME-4150 is ideal for VME-based control systems, including GE Mark VI, where reliable analog output and isolation are critical for safety and precision.
Product Parameters
| Parameter | Details |
|---|---|
| Module Type | Isolated 12-bit Analog Output Board (GE VMIVME-4150) |
| Core Function | Analog signal output; channel isolation; software-selectable ranges; readback & diagnostics |
| Form Factor | 6U VMEbus single-slot board |
| Channel Configurations | 4, 8, 12 isolated channels |
| Resolution | 12-bit DAC |
| Voltage Ranges | ±2.5V, ±5V, ±10V (bipolar); 0-2.5V/0-5V/0-10V (unipolar) |
| Current Loop (Optional) | 4-20mA, 0-20mA, 5-25mA |
| Isolation | 1000 VDC standard (1500 VDC optional) |
| Accuracy | 0.05% (voltage); 0.08% (current loop) |
| Load Capacity | 10 mA (voltage outputs over ±10V range) |
| Power Input | +5V DC, +12V DC, -12V DC; ≤25W |
| Operating Temperature | -40°C to +70°C |
| Compliance | VMEbus standard; MIL-STD-810F (vibration); MIL-STD-883H (shock) |
